What to Look for in Best Grey Vase with Pampas Grass
Choosing the Right Grey
Opt for cool charcoal for modern spaces or soft slate to complement neutral farmhouse decor.
Vase Material Matters
A matte ceramic finish provides the best contrast against the wispy, delicate texture of faux pampas.
Ideal Stem Height
Select stems that are double the height of your vase to create a professional, balanced silhouette.
Volume and Density
Look for high-count bundles to ensure your arrangement looks full and prevents a sparse, thin appearance.
Texture and Shedding
Choose high-quality synthetic fibers to avoid the mess of shedding while maintaining a realistic, fluffy aesthetic.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I style a grey vase with pampas grass?
Place your grey vase on a console table or mantel to serve as a neutral anchor. Fan out the pampas grass stems to create height and volume, ensuring they don't look too crowded at the base.
Does grey pampas grass look natural?
Modern faux options use varied tones to mimic natural grasses. When paired with a grey vase, the monochromatic look offers a sophisticated, contemporary vibe that feels intentional.
How many stems do I need for a full look?
For a standard medium-sized vase, aim for at least 30 to 50 stems. This ensures the arrangement feels dense and luxurious rather than thin.
Is a ceramic vase better than glass for pampas?
Ceramic is generally preferred because it hides the stems and provides a solid, opaque base. This allows the focus to remain entirely on the texture of the pampas grass.
Can I mix grey pampas with other colors?
Absolutely, grey pampas pairs beautifully with white or cream stems for a layered look. The grey vase acts as a grounding element that ties different shades together.
How do I clean faux pampas grass?
Use a hairdryer on a cool, low-speed setting to gently blow away dust. Avoid water, as it can damage the synthetic fibers and alter their shape.
